Transaction 2ed8a969fdc015d83ff5449f1f81ff555ef05656d3ba1c3f935be9e592d42568

15 Input
1 Outputs
  • 2ed8a969fdc015d83ff5449f1f81ff555ef05656d3ba1c3f935be9e592d42568:0
  • value  3969743
    address  3KRsALnU2qi65YcntRwAXf7QKCdubf11He